Introduction

This manual provides detailed instructions for the safe and efficient operation of your Bonsenkitchen Multi-Functional Food Sealer Machine, Model VS3017-S1. Please read this manual thoroughly before use and retain it for future reference.

The Bonsenkitchen Vacuum Sealer is designed to extend the freshness of your food by removing air from specially designed bags and containers, preventing freezer burn and spoilage. It features multiple operating modes and a convenient built-in cutter for ease of use.

Setup and First Use

  1. Unpack the Appliance: Carefully remove the vacuum sealer and all accessories from the packaging.
  2. Inspect for Damage: Check the appliance for any signs of damage. Do not use if damaged.
  3. Clean the Appliance: Wipe the exterior of the vacuum sealer with a damp cloth. Ensure it is completely dry before plugging in.
  4. Power Connection: Plug the power cord into a standard electrical outlet.
  5. Prepare Bags: If using a roll, use the built-in cutter to create a bag of the desired length. Seal one end of the bag using the "Seal" function (see Operating Modes).

Operating Modes

Your Bonsenkitchen Vacuum Sealer offers four distinct operating modes:

  1. Dry Mode: For non-liquid foods such as sausages, nuts, or coffee beans. This mode automatically vacuums and seals the bag.
  2. Vac Mode (Pulse Vac): For soft or fragile foods like bread, berries, or marinated items. This mode allows manual control over the vacuum process, preventing crushing. Press and hold the "Pulse Vac" button until the desired vacuum level is reached, then release. The machine will automatically seal.
  3. Seal Mode: For quick sealing of bags without vacuuming. Ideal for snack bags or creating custom-sized bags from a roll.
  4. Accessory Mode: For external vacuum applications using the accessory hose with compatible containers like wine bottles or jars.

Using the Built-in Cutter and Roll Storage

The vacuum sealer includes a built-in cutter and storage compartment for vacuum sealer rolls, allowing you to create custom-sized bags efficiently.

  1. Open the Lid: Press the "Release" buttons on both sides of the machine to open the lid.
  2. Insert Roll: Place the vacuum sealer roll into the designated storage area.
  3. Pull Out Bag Material: Pull out the desired length of bag material.
  4. Cut Bag: Slide the cutter from left to right to cut the bag material.
  5. Seal One End: Close the lid and use the "Seal" function to seal one end of the newly cut bag, creating a pouch.

External Vacuum Sealing with Accessory Hose

The accessory hose allows you to vacuum seal compatible external containers, such as canisters, jars, or wine bottles.

  1. Connect Hose: Insert one end of the accessory hose into the outer port on the left side of the vacuum machine.
  2. Connect to Container: Connect the other side of the hose to the vacuum port of your external container.
  3. Start Vacuuming: Press the "Power" button, then select the "Accessory" button to begin pumping air out of the container.
  4. Monitor Process: The machine will stop automatically once the desired vacuum level is achieved in the container.

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your vacuum sealer, refer to the following common solutions: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Machine does not power on.Not plugged in; power button not pressed.Ensure power cord is securely plugged in. Press the "Power" button.
Bag does not vacuum properly.Bag not correctly placed; lid not fully latched; sealing strip dirty.Ensure the open end of the bag is flat and fully inside the vacuum chamber. Press down firmly on both sides of the lid until it clicks. Clean the sealing strip.
Bag does not seal.Sealing strip dirty or wet; bag material incompatible.Clean and dry the sealing strip. Use only Bonsenkitchen vacuum bags or compatible textured bags.
Air leaks after sealing.Wrinkle in bag; puncture in bag; insufficient sealing time.Smooth out any wrinkles before sealing. Inspect bag for punctures. Ensure proper sealing time (machine automatically adjusts).

Specifications

FeatureDetail
BrandBonsenkitchen
Model NumberVS3017-S1
ColorBlack
Product Dimensions15.42"L x 6.98"W x 2.92"H
Power SourceAC
Operation ModeSemi-Automatic
Wattage135 watts
Voltage120 Volts
Item Weight4.38 pounds
